BackgroundMaternal thyroid dysfunction and autoantibodies were associated with preterm delivery. However, recommendations for cutoff values of thyroperoxidase antibody (TPOAb) positivity and thyroid-stimulating homone (TSH) associated with premature delivery are lacking.ObjectiveTo identify the pregnancy-specific cutoff values for TPOAb positivity and TSH associated with preterm delivery. To develop a nomogram for the risk prediction of premature delivery based on maternal thyroid function in singleton pregnant women without pre-pregnancy complications.MethodsThis study included data from the International Peace Maternity and Child Care Health Hospital (IPMCH) in Shanghai, China, between January 2013 and December 2016. Added data between September 2019 and November 2019 as the test cohort. Youden’s index calculated the pregnancy-specific cutoff values for TPOAb positivity and TSH concentration. Univariate and multivariable logistic regression analysis were used to screen the risk factors of premature delivery. The nomogram was developed according to the regression coefficient of relevant variables. Discrimination and calibration of the model were assessed using the C-index, Hosmer-Lemeshow test, calibration curve and decision curve analysis.Results45,467 pregnant women were divided into the training and validation cohorts according to the ratio of 7: 3. The testing cohort included 727 participants. The pregnancy-specific cutoff values associated with the risk of premature delivery during the first trimester were 5.14 IU/mL for TPOAb positivity and 1.33 mU/L for TSH concentration. Multivariable logistic regression analysis showed that maternal age, history of premature delivery, elevated TSH concentration and TPOAb positivity in the early pregnancy, preeclampsia and gestational diabetes mellitus were risk factors of premature delivery. The C-index was 0.62 of the nomogram. Hosmer-Lemeshow test showed that the Chi-square value was 2.64 (P = 0.955 > 0.05). Decision curve analysis showed a positive net benefit. The calibration curves of three cohorts were shown to be in good agreement.ConclusionsWe identified the pregnancy-specific cutoff values for TPOAb positivity and TSH concentration associated with preterm delivery in singleton pregnant women without pre-pregnancy complications. We developed a nomogram to predict the occurrence of premature delivery based on thyroid function and other risk factors as a clinical decision-making tool.

ObjectiveAberrations in maternal thyroid function and autoimmunity during pregnancy have been associated with negative obstetric outcome. In Denmark, a national iodine fortification program was implemented in the year 2000 with the aim to alleviate the mild-moderate iodine deficiency. Following the iodine implementation, there has been an increase in thyroid autoimmunity in the background population. This study investigates the thyroid status of pregnant Danish women following the iodine fortification program, and a possible association with preterm delivery.DesignHistorical cohort study of 1278 randomly selected pregnant Danish women attending the national Down's syndrome screening program.MethodsThe main outcome measures were thyroid status according to laboratory- and gestational-age-specific reference intervals, and association with risk of abnormal obstetric outcome. Antibody-positivity was defined as an antibody-level (thyroid peroxidase and/or thyroglobulin antibodies) above 60 U/ml.ResultsEstablishing laboratory-specific gestational-age-dependent reference intervals, we found a prevalence of maternal thyroid dysfunction of 10%–15.8% by use of the cut-off suggested by the American Thyroid Association. Thyroid dysfunction was significantly associated with antibody-positivity (P<0.05). No associations were found between preterm delivery and thyroid dysfunction (adjusted OR 0.6, 95% CI: 0.1–2.3) or autoimmunity (adjusted OR 1.1, 95% CI: 0.4–2.7).ConclusionsAfter the implementation of the Danish iodine fortification program, the prevalence of thyroid dysfunction and autoimmunity in Danish pregnant women is high – even higher by use of pre-established reference intervals from international consensus guidelines. However, no associations were found with abnormal obstetric outcome. Large randomized controlled trials are needed to clarify the benefit of treating slight aberrations in pregnant women's thyroid function.

AbstractUndiagnosed thyroid disease is a common problem with significant public health implications. This is especially true during pregnancy, when the health of both the mother and the developing child can be adversely affected by abnormal maternal thyroid function. Measurement of serum thyroid stimulating hormone (TSH) and thyroid peroxidase antibodies (TPO-Ab) are two common ways to assess maternal thyroid status. The objective of our study was to determine the prevalence of abnormal TSH and TPO-Ab tests in a population of pregnant women in the Samara region of the Russian Federation. Serum samples were obtained from 1588 pregnant women as part of their routine antenatal care. TSH and TPO-Ab were measured, and trimester-specific reference values for TSH (2.5–97.5 percentiles) were calculated using TPO-Ab-negative women. TSH results outside these ranges were considered abnormal; TPO-Ab levels outside the manufacturer's reference range (>12IU/mL) were considered abnormal. Overall, the prevalence of abnormal results was 6.3% for TSH and 10.7% for TPO-Ab. High TSH (>97.5 trimester-specific percentile) and TPO-Ab-positive results were most common in the first trimester (5.7% and 13.8%, respectively). TSH levels were associated with gestational age and TPO-Ab status, and with maternal age in TPO-Ab-negative women. TPO-Ab status was associated with both maternal and gestational age. Women with TSH >2.5mIU/L had a significantly increased risk of being TPO-Ab-positive, and this risk increased with age. Based on our data, we conclude that abnormal TSH and TPO-Ab are common in pregnant women of the Samara region. Given the association of thyroid dysfunction to adverse pregnancy outcomes, screening of this population for abnormal thyroid function should be considered.

Background. Maternal thyroid dysfunction in early pregnancy may increase the risk of adverse pregnancy complications and neurocognitive deficiencies in the developing fetus. Currently, some researchers demonstrated that body mass index (BMI) is associated with thyroid function in nonpregnant population. Hence, the American Thyroid Association recommended screening thyroid function in obese pregnant women; however, the evidence for this is weak. For this purpose, our study investigated the relationship between high BMI and thyroid functions during early pregnancy in Liaoning province, an iodine-sufficient region of China.Methods. Serum thyroid stimulating hormone (TSH), free thyroxine (FT4), thyroid-peroxidase antibody (TPOAb), thyroglobulin antibody (TgAb) concentration, urinary iodine concentration (UIC), and BMI were determined in 6303 pregnant women.Results. BMI ≥ 25 kg/m2may act as an indicator of hypothyroxinemia and TPOAb positivity and BMI ≥ 30 kg/m2was associated with increases in the odds of hypothyroidism, hypothyroxinemia, and TPOAb positivity. The prevalence of isolated hypothyroxinemia increased among pregnant women with BMI > 24 kg/m2.Conclusions. High BMI during early pregnancy may be an indicator of maternal thyroid dysfunction; for Asian women whose BMI > 24 kg/m2and who are within 8 weeks of pregnancy, thyroid functions should be assessed especially.

Descriptores: factores de riesgo, parto pre término, parto a término, pre eclampsia. ABSTRACT Preterm birth occurs between 22 and before 37 weeks. Its etiology is multifactorial and is a major cause of perinatal morbidity and mortality. The objective was to determine the risk factors associated with preterm delivery in pregnant women Guillermo Almenara Irigoyen National Hospital from January to June 2010. We performed a retrospective case - control and descriptive. The case histories of patients and controls were reviewed and recorded in chips and processed with SPSS version 15. The results were 81 patients diagnosed with preterm birth, with statistical significance in the following variables: absence of prenatal care (OR 3.07, P> 0.05), pre-eclampsia (OR 20.86, P <0.001), premature rupture of membranes (OR 4.03, P> 0,005), multiple pregnancy (OR 5.64, P> 0.01), chorioamnionitis (OR 2.02, P> 0.1), place of birth: saw (OR 3.88, P> 0.05) and socioeconomic status (OR12.73, P> 0.05). It was evident that more poor pregnant women with less education have a higher incidence of preterm delivery [1] [2] [3]. That 21% of preterm births was associated with premature rupture of membranes (OR 4.03) data that is within the range of incidence, as Aagaard-Tillery [4] (2005) noted an incidence of premature rupture preterm membrane between 30 and 40% and Fabian (2008) observed 11.67% of premature rupture of membranes [5]. Pregnant women with preeclampsia had a 20 times higher risk of preterm birth present. 34.6% presented with preterm birth pre-eclampsia, of which 42.8% was severe preeclampsia, 25% and 32.14% mild HELLP syndrome; data Salviz similar to that observed in their study in the Cayetano Heredia Hospital, where he found a 30 % of preterm birth in patients with preeclampsia, although it is known that pre-eclampsia affects 3 to 5% of pregnancies, no studies on the incidence of preeclampsia in preterm labor [6]. We conclude that the main risk factor associated with preterm delivery was preeclampsia. Being born in the mountains, belong to socioeconomic status, lack of prenatal care, premature rupture of membranes, coriomanionitis and multiple pregnancy were also significant. Keywords: risk factors, preterm delivery, term delivery, pre-eclampsia.

Introduction: Preterm delivery is the delivery before 37 weeks of gestation are completed. Preterm birth is a major course of neonatal morbidity and mortality, the incidence of premature delivery in developedcountries is 5 to 9%. Aims of this study were to determine the common etiological factors for preterm delivery, most common weeks of gestation for pretern delivery, and most commom way of delivery for preterm delivery.Methods: The study included 600 patients divided into two groups, experimental group (included 300 preterm delivered pregnant women), control group (included 300 term delivered women).Results: The incidence of preterm delivery in pregnant women younger than 18 years was 4.4%, and in pregnant women older than 35 years was 14%. 44.6 % of preterm delivered women at the experimentalgroup had lower education. In the experimental group burdened obstetrical history had 29%, 17.2% had a preterm delivery, 35.6% had a premature rupture of membranes, 15% had a preterm delivery before32 weeks of gestation, 12.4% between 32-33.6 weeks of gestation, while 72.6% of deliveries were between 34- 36.6 weeks of gestation. Multiple pregnancy as an etiological factor was present in 10.07% ofcases. Extragenital diseases were present in 10.4%. In the experimental group there were 29%, while in the control group there were 15% subjects with burdened obstetrical history.Conclusions: Preterm birth more often occurs in a pregnant women younger than 18 and older than 35 years, and in a pregnant women of lower educational degree. Preterm delivery in the most commoncases was fi nished in period from 34 to 36.6 weeks of gestation. The most common etiological factor of preterm delivery in the experimental group was preterm rupture of membranes and idiopathic pretermdelivery.

Although evidence suggests that maternal hypothyroidism and mild hypothyroxinemia during the first half of pregnancy alters fetal neurodevelopment among euthyroid offspring, little data are available from later in gestation. In this study, we measured free T4 using direct equilibrium dialysis, as well as total T4 and TSH in 287 pregnant women at 27 weeks' gestation. We also assessed cognition, memory, language, motor functioning, and behavior in their children at 6, 12, 24, and 60 months of age. Increasing maternal TSH was related to better performance on tests of cognition and language at 12 months but not at later ages. At 60 months, there was inconsistent evidence that higher TSH was related to improved attention. We found no convincing evidence that maternal TH during the second half of pregnancy was related to impaired child neurodevelopment.

Background: Maternal thyroid dysfunction has been associated with a variety of adverse pregnancy outcomes. Laboratory measurement of thyroid function plays an important role in the assessment of maternal thyroid health. However, occult thyroid disease and physiologic changes associated with pregnancy can complicate interpretation of maternal thyroid function tests (TFTs). Objective and methods: To 1) establish the prevalence of laboratory evidence for autoimmune thyroid disease (AITD) in pregnant women; 2) establish gestational age-specific reference intervals for TFTs in women without AITD; and 3) examine the influence of reference intervals on the interpretation of TFT in pregnant women. Serum samples were collected from 2272 pregnant women, and TFT performed. Gestational age-specific reference intervals were determined in women without AITD, and then compared with the non-pregnant assay-specific reference intervals for interpretation of testing results. Results: Thyroid peroxidase antibodies (TPO-Ab) and thyroglobulin antibodies (Tg-Ab) were positive in 10.4 and 15.7% of women respectively. TPO-Ab level was related to maternal age, but TPO-Ab status, Tg-Ab status, and Tg-Ab level were not. Women with TSH > 3.0 mIU/l were significantly more likely to be TPO-Ab positive. Gestational age-specific reference intervals for TFT were significantly different from non-pregnant normal reference intervals. Interpretation of TFT in pregnant women using non-pregnant reference intervals could potentially result in misclassification of a significant percentage of results (range: 5.6–18.3%). Conclusion: Laboratory evidence for thyroid dysfunction was common in this population of pregnant women. Accurate classification of TFT in pregnant women requires the use of gestational age-specific reference intervals.

Background: Pregnancy has great influence on maternal thyroid gland. It induces significant physiological as well as hormonal changes that alters the maternal thyroid function. Our goal was to determine this pregnancy associated changes in thyroid gland. Objective: To correlate the sonographic findings of maternal thyroid gland with thyroid function tests during pregnancy. Material and methods: 135 pregnant women were recruited in this study, data of TSH, T3 and T4 was obtained and correlated it with the sonographic findings of maternal thyroid gland in each trimester of pregnancy. Results: In the 135 sampled pregnant women, mean thyroid gland volume was 4.08±1.19 cm3. The mean levels of T3, T4 and TSH were v3.37±.44 pmol/L, 14.96±2.49 pmol/L and 1.21±.92 mIU/L respectively. A remarkable correlation between thyroid hormones and thyroid volume was observed. Conclusion: It is concluded that the ultra-sonographic findings is correlated with the thyroid function tests during pregnancy.

Background: Although preterm delivery and low birth weight (LBW) have been studied in India, findings may not be generalisable to rural areas such as the Marathwada region of Maharashtra state. There is limited information available on maternal and child health indicators from this region. We aimed to present some local estimates of preterm delivery and LBW in the Osmanabad district of Marathwada and assess available maternal risk factors. Methods: The study used routinely collected data on all in-hospital births in the maternity department of Halo Medical Foundation’s hospital from 1st January 2008 to 31st December 2014. Multivariable logistic regression analysis provided odds ratios (OR) with 95% confidence intervals (CI) for preterm delivery and LBW according to each maternal risk factor. Results: We analysed 655 live births, of which 6.1% were preterm deliveries. Of the full term births (N=615), 13.8% were LBW (<2.5 kilograms at birth). The odds of preterm delivery were three times higher (OR=3.23, 95% CI 1.36 to 7.65) and the odds of LBW were double (OR=2.03, 95% CI 1.14 to 3.60) among women <22 years of age compared with older women. The odds of both preterm delivery and LBW were reduced in multigravida compared with primigravida women regardless of age. Anaemia (Hb<11g/dl), which was prevalent in 91% of women tested, was not significantly related to these birth outcomes. Conclusions: The odds of preterm delivery and LBW were much higher in mothers under 22 years of age in this rural Indian population. Future studies should explore other related risk factors and the reasons for poor birth outcomes in younger mothers in this population, to inform the design of appropriate public health policies that address this issue.

Abstract Objective Thyroid diseases are the second most common endocrine disorders in the reproductive period of women. They can be associated with intrauterine growth restriction (IUGR), preterm delivery, low Apgar score, low birthweight (LBW) or fetal death. The aim of the present study is to explore thyroid dysfunction and its relationship with some poor perinatal outcomes (Apgar Score, low birthweight, and preterm delivery). Methods Dried blood spot samples from 358 healthy pregnant women were analyzed for thyroid stimulating hormone (TSH), total thyroxine (TT4), and thyroglobulin (Tg). Neonatal data were collected upon delivery. Four groups were formed based on thyroid function tests (TFTs). Results Of the 358 tested women, 218 (60.72%) were euthyroid. Isolated hypothyroxinemia was present in 132 women (36.76%), subclinical hyperthyroidism in 7 women (1.94%), and overt hypothyroidism in 1 (0.28%). The perinatal outcomes IUGR (p = 0.028) and Apgar score 1 minute (p = 0.015) were significantly different between thyroid function test [TFT]-distinct groups. In the multiple regression analysis, TT4 showed a statistically significant inverse predictive impact on LBW (p < 0.0001), but a positive impact of Tg on LBW (p = 0.0351). Conclusion Thyroid hormones alone do not have a direct impact on neonatal outcomes, but the percentage of their participation in the total process cannot be neglected. Based on the regression analysis, we can conclude that TT4 and Tg can be used as predictors of neonatal outcome, expressed through birthweight and Apgar score. The present study aims to contribute to determine whether a test for thyroid status should become routine screening during pregnancy.
